物联网流量平台在数据加密方面有哪些技术?
随着物联网技术的飞速发展,物联网流量平台在各个行业中的应用越来越广泛。然而,数据安全问题始终是物联网领域的一大挑战。为了确保数据传输的安全性和隐私性,数据加密技术成为物联网流量平台不可或缺的一部分。本文将深入探讨物联网流量平台在数据加密方面所采用的技术。
一、对称加密技术
对称加密技术是指加密和解密使用相同的密钥。这种技术的主要优点是加密速度快,实现简单。常见的对称加密算法有:
AES(高级加密标准):AES是一种广泛使用的对称加密算法,具有很高的安全性。它支持128位、192位和256位密钥长度,可以有效地保护数据安全。
DES(数据加密标准):DES是一种较早的对称加密算法,采用56位密钥。虽然DES的安全性较低,但在一些特定场景下仍然可以使用。
3DES(三重数据加密算法):3DES是DES的改进版本,通过使用三个密钥进行加密和解密,提高了安全性。
二、非对称加密技术
非对称加密技术是指加密和解密使用不同的密钥。这种技术的主要优点是安全性高,可以实现身份认证和数字签名。常见的非对称加密算法有:
RSA(公钥加密标准):RSA是一种广泛使用的非对称加密算法,具有很高的安全性。它使用两个密钥:公钥和私钥。公钥用于加密,私钥用于解密。
ECC(椭圆曲线加密):ECC是一种基于椭圆曲线数学的非对称加密算法,具有很高的安全性。与RSA相比,ECC在相同的安全级别下,所需的密钥长度更短,计算速度更快。
ECDSA(椭圆曲线数字签名算法):ECDSA是一种基于ECC的非对称加密算法,用于数字签名。
三、哈希算法
哈希算法是一种将任意长度的数据映射到固定长度的数据的技术。常见的哈希算法有:
MD5(消息摘要5):MD5是一种广泛使用的哈希算法,具有很高的安全性。然而,近年来发现MD5存在一定的安全隐患,已不再推荐使用。
SHA-1(安全哈希算法1):SHA-1是一种常用的哈希算法,具有很高的安全性。然而,与MD5类似,SHA-1也存在安全隐患。
SHA-256:SHA-256是一种基于SHA-2算法的哈希算法,具有很高的安全性。它被认为是目前最安全的哈希算法之一。
四、案例分享
以某智能家居平台为例,该平台采用AES和RSA算法进行数据加密。用户登录时,平台使用RSA算法生成一对密钥,公钥用于加密用户名和密码,私钥用于解密。数据传输过程中,平台使用AES算法对数据进行加密,确保数据传输的安全性。
总结
物联网流量平台在数据加密方面采用了多种技术,包括对称加密、非对称加密和哈希算法等。这些技术共同保障了数据传输的安全性和隐私性。随着物联网技术的不断发展,数据加密技术也将不断进步,为物联网领域的发展提供有力保障。
猜你喜欢:云原生可观测性